TSM players Kim "DuBu" Du-young and Enzo "Timado" Gianoli O'Connor, as well as coach Rasmus Berz 'MISERY' Philipsen spoke about expectations from The International 2022 and preparations for the tournament in a video for the club's YouTube channel.
TSM interview with Timado: Now we put all our time, all our soul, all our energy into getting better

DuBu on expectations from The International 2022

I think our training is going well. We know what we want to do, we know what we want to pick. I don't have high expectations. I just want to play my game and see what happens.

Timado about training

Now we train more and more. Until a year ago, when we first started as North America Team Undying, things were more relaxed. Now we are investing all our time, all our soul, all our energy to become better.

MISERY about SabeRLighT-

With SabeRLighT- Canada bryle was able to return to his usual mid-lane role. SabeRLighT- has a lot of niche heroes that we've been using a lot in the last couple of weeks at the bootcamp. We will try to take advantage of this. He can start fights and sometimes take a hit in the interests of the team.

Recall thatTSM qualified for The International 2022 by DPC points and will start playing at the tournament from the group stage on October 15th.
